What truly set the film apart from its contemporaries was its aggressive use of computer-generated imagery (CGI) and digital post-production. The movie featured over 300 visual effects shots, including digital oceans, supernatural skeleton warriors, and elaborate naval battles. It was shot entirely on high-definition cameras, a rarity for the industry in 2005, making it a benchmark title used by tech electronics companies to showcase the capabilities of early HD televisions. At the time of its release, made headlines as the most expensive adult film ever produced , with a budget of roughly $1 million . While that figure is pocket change for a Disney production, it was astronomical for the adult industry in 2005.
